The Register has unveiled their "cynic's guide to desktop Linux," which they ultimately concede is a snarky yet affectionate list of "the least bad distros."

For those who are "sick of Windows but can't afford a Mac," the article begins by addressing people who complain there's too many Linux distros to choose from. "We thought we'd simplify things for you by listing how and in which ways the different options suck." - The year of Linux on the desktop came and went, and nobody noticed — maybe because it doesn't say "Linux" on it. ChromeOS only runs on ChromeBooks and ChromeBoxes, but they outsold Macs for a while before the pandemic. "Flex" is the version for ordinary PCs... ChromeOS Flex works great, because it only does one thing: browse the web. You can't install apps, not even Android ones: only official kit does that. You can run Debian containers: if you know what that means, go run Debian. If you don't know what that means, trust us, you don't want to.

- Ubuntu is an ancient African word that means I can't configure Debian....

- Mint is an Ubuntu remix with knobs on. It was an also-ran for years, but when Ubuntu went all Mac-like it saw its chance and grabbed it — along with the number one spot in the charts. It dispenses with some of the questionable bits of recent Ubuntu, such as GNOME and Snaps, but replaces them with dodgy bits of its own, such as a confusing choice of not one, not two, but three Windows-like desktops, and overly cautious approaches to updates and upgrades.

- Debian is the daddy of free distros, and the one that invented the idea of a packaging tool that automatically installs dependencies. It's easier than it used to be, but mired in politics. It's sort of like Ubuntu, but more out of date, harder to install, and with fewer drivers. If that sounds just your sort of thing, go for it.

There's 10 snarky entries in all, zinging Fedora, openSUSE, Arch Linux, and Pop!_OS — as well as the various spinoffs of Red Hat Enterprise Linux. (The article calls Rocky Linux and AlmaLinux "RHEL with the serial numbers filed off.")

And there's also one final catch-call entry for "Tiny obscure distros. All of them."

New Data Shows Only Two Browsers With More Than 1 Billion Users (arstechnica.com) 111

An anonymous reader quotes a report from Ars Technica: Apple's Safari web browser has more than 1 billion users, according to an estimate by Atlas VPN. Only one other browser has more than a billion users, and that's Google's Chrome. But at nearly 3.4 billion, Chrome still leaves Safari in the dust. It's important to note that these numbers include mobile users, not just desktop users. Likely, Safari's status as the default browser for both the iPhone and iPad plays a much bigger role than its usage on the Mac. Still, it's impressive given that Safari is the only major web browser not available on Android, which is the world's most popular mobile operating system, or Windows, the most popular desktop OS. "The statistics are based on the GlobalStats browser market share percentage, which was then converted into numbers using the Internet World Stats internet user metric to retrieve the exact numbers," explains Atlas VPN in a blog post.

'Turn an Old PC Into a High-End Amiga with AmiKit' (amiga.sk) 76

Mike Bouma (Slashdot reader #85,252) writes: AmiKit is a compilation of pre-installed and pre-configured Amiga programs running emulated on Windows, macOS, and Linux (as well as running on classic 68K Amigas expanded with a Vampire upgrade card).

Besides original Workbench (Commodore's desktop environment/graphical filemanager), AmiKit provides Directory Opus Magellan and Scalos as desktop replacements and its "Rabbit Hole" feature allows you to launch Windows, Mac or Linux applications directly from your Amiga desktop! Anti-aliased fonts, Full HD 32-bit screen modes and DualPNG Icons support is included and this package comes with exclusive versions of the Master Control Program (MCP) and MUI 5 (Magic User Interface).

The original AmigaOS (version 3.x) and Kickstart ROM (version 3.1) are required, also the recently released AmigaOS 3.2 is supported. You can also get the needed files from the Amiga Forever package(s). It even supports emulating AmigaOS 4.x (for PowerPC) easily through Flower Pot.

Here's an extensive overview video by Dan Wood. An Amiga Future review of an earlier 2017 version can be read here.

"Everything began in 1994 when my parents bought an Amiga 500 for me and my brother," explains AmiKit's developer.

"I was 14 years old..." Fast forward to 2005, the AmiKit was born — an emulated environment including more than 350 programs. It fully replaced my old Amiga and it became a legend in the community over the years.

Fast forward to 2017, a brand new AmiKit X is released, originally developed for A.L.I.C.E., followed by the XE version released in 2019, Vampire edition in 2020 and Raspberry Pi in 2021. The latest & greatest version was released in 2020.

Google is Rolling Out Chrome 102 with 32 Security Fixes, One Critical (zdnet.com) 10

This week Google began a rolling release for stable Chrome version 102 "with 32 security fixes for browser on Windows, Mac and Linux," reports ZDNet: Chrome 102 for the desktop includes 32 security fixes reported to Google by external researchers. There's one critical flaw, while eight are high severity, nine are medium severity, and seven are low severity. Google also creates other fixes for issues found through internal testing...

The critical flaw, labelled as CVE-2022-1853, is a 'use after free in IndexedDB', an interface for applications to store data in a user's browser.... "My guess is that an attacker could construct a specially crafted website and take over the visitor's browser by manipulating the IndexedDB," says Pieter Arntz, a malware intelligence researcher at Malwarebytes. None of the flaws fixed in this Chrome 102 stable release were zero days, meaning flaws that were exploited before Google released a patch for it.

Google's Project Zero (GPZ) team last year counted 58 zero-day exploits for popular software in 2021. Twenty-five of these were in browsers, of which 14 affected Chrome. Google engineers argue zero-day counts are rising because vendors are improving detection, fixes and disclosure. However, GPZ researchers argue the industry as a whole is not making zero days hard enough for attackers, who often rely on tweaking existing flaws rather than being forced to conjure up entirely new exploitation methods.

Corey B. Marion, Co-Founder of The Iconfactory, Dies Age 54 (appleinsider.com) 8

Designer and co-founder of The Iconfactory, Corey B. Marion, has died following a long battle with cancer. He was 54. AppleInsider reports: Marion founded The Iconfactory in 1996 with Talos Tsui, and Gedeon Maheux, when he was 29. For a quarter of a century, he led the firm while also designing icons -- including the company's own factory logo one -- and created a typeface based on his own handwriting. [...] The Iconfactory produces sets of icons, such as free ones commissioned by Paramount to promote a "Star Trek" film, and over 100 for Microsoft Windows XP. Corey designed logos, emojis, and wallpapers too. Plus from 1997 to 2004, he was a judge on The Iconfactory's annual Pixelpalooza icon design contest, created specifically for the Mac community. Epic Games Points To Mac's Openness and Security in Its Latest Filing in App Store Antitrust Case (techcrunch.com) 71

In a new court filing, Epic Games challenges Apple's position that third-party app stores would compromise the iPhone's security. And it points to Apple's macOS as an example of how the process of "sideloading" apps -- installing apps outside of Apple's own App Store, that is -- doesn't have to be the threat Apple describes it to be. From a report: Apple's Mac, explains Epic, doesn't have the same constraints as found in the iPhone operating system, iOS, and yet Apple touts the operating system used in Mac computers, macOS, as secure. The Cary, N.C.-based Fortnite maker made these points in its latest brief, among several others, related to its ongoing legal battle with Apple over its control of the App Store. Epic Games wants to earn the right to deliver Fortnite to iPhone users outside the App Store, or at the very least, be able to use its own payment processing system so it can stop paying Apple commissions for the ability to deliver its software to iPhone users.

Apple Patches Dozens of Security Flaws With iOS 15.5, Over 50 Fixes For macOS 12.4 (9to5mac.com) 21

Apple has released iOS 15.5, macOS 12.4, and more today with updates like new features for Apple Cash, the Podcasts app, and the Studio Display webcam fix. However, a bigger reason to update your devices is the security patches with today's releases. iOS 15.5 includes almost 30 security fixes while macOS 12.4 features over 50. 9to5Mac reports: Apple shared all the details for the security fixes in its latest software for iPhone, iPad, Mac, and more on its support page. For both iOS and Mac, many of the flaws could allow malicious apps to execute arbitrary code with kernel privileges. Another for iOS says "A remote attacker may be able to cause unexpected application termination or arbitrary code execution." Specifically on Mac, one of the 50+ flaws fixed was that "Photo location information may persist after it is removed with Preview Inspector." Important security updates are also available for macOS Big Sur with 11.6.6, macOS Catalina, Xcode 13.4, and watchOS 8.6.

Apple Silicon Exclusively Hit With World-First 'Augury' DMP Vulnerability (tomshardware.com) 67

An anonymous reader quotes a report from Tom's Hardware: A team of researchers with the University of Illinois Urbana-Champaign, Tel Aviv University, and the University of Washington have demonstrated a world-first Data Memory-Dependent Prefetcher (DMP) vulnerability, dubbed "Augury," that's exclusive to Apple Silicon. If exploited, the vulnerability could allow attackers to siphon off "at rest" data, meaning the data doesn't even need to be accessed by the processing cores to be exposed. Augury takes advantage of Apple Silicon's DMP feature. This prefetcher aims to improve system performance by being aware of the entire memory content, which allows it to improve system performance by pre-fetching data before it's needed. Usually, memory access is limited and compartmentalized in order to increase system security, but Apple's DMP prefetch can overshoot the set of memory pointers, allowing it to access and attempt a prefetch of unrelated memory addresses up to its prefetch depth.

If you feel your mind grasping at a certain familiarity with this, it's likely because the infamous Spectre/Meltdown vulnerabilities also try and speculate what data will be required by the system before it's even requested (hence the term speculative execution). But while side-channel vulnerabilities such as Spectre and Meltdown are only capable of leaking in-use data, Apple's DMP can potentially leak the entire memory content even if it's not being actively accessed. The nature of Apple's DMP also renders void some of the already-engineered fixes for speculative execution vulnerabilities -- those that rely on controlling what is visible to the processing cores.
The researchers said that Apple is fully aware of their discoveries, but there are no plans for whether or not the company will deploy mitigations.

Mac Studio's M1 Ultra Chip Outperforms on Computational Fluid Dynamics Benchmarks (hrtapps.com) 63

Dr. Craig Hunter is a mechanical/aerospace engineer with over 25 years of experience in software development. And now Dixie_Flatline (Slashdot reader #5,077) describes Hunter's latest experiment: Craig Hunter has been running Computational Fluid Dynamics (CFD) benchmarks on Macs for years--he has results going back to 2010 with an Intel Xeon 5650, with the most recent being a 28-core Xeon W from 2019. He has this to say about why he thinks CFD benchmarks are a good test: "As shown above, we see a pretty typical trend where machines get less and less efficient as more and more cores join the computation. This happens because the computational work begins to saturate communications on the system as data and MPI instructions pass between the cores and memory, creating overhead. It's what makes parallel CFD computations such a great real world benchmark. Unlike simpler benchmarks that tend to make CPUs look good, the CFD benchmark stresses the entire system and shows us how things hold up as conditions become more and more challenging."

With just 6 cores, the Mac Studio's M1 Ultra surpasses the 2019 Xeon before literally going off the original chart. He had to double the x-axis just to fit the M1's performance in. Unsurprisingly, he seems impressed:

"We know from Apple's specs and marketing materials that the M1 Ultra has an extremely high 800 GB/sec memory bandwidth and an even faster 2.5 TB/sec interface between the two M1 Max chips that make up the M1 Ultra, and it shows in the CFD benchmark. This leads to a level of CPU performance scaling that I don't even see on supercomputers."

Apple Reports Best March Quarter Ever (theverge.com) 15

Even as it deals with continued supply constraints and consumers wary of inflation, Apple today reported the best March quarter in its history. The Verge reports: The company tallied $97.3 billion in revenue in Q2, up 9 percent over the year-ago quarter. That amounted to a profit of $25 billion, with earnings per share of $1.52. Apple set March quarter revenue records for its iPhone, Mac, and Wearables / Home / Accessories divisions. But the second quarter saw a slowdown in iPad sales, which were down slightly year over year. Apple's various services grew to a new high of 825 million subscribers, up 165 million from the total a year ago.

The increase in iPhone revenue comes even after Apple noted that the year-ago Q2 saw very strong iPhone demand due to the iPhone 12 series launching a bit later in the fall than normal. New products released by Apple during the March quarter included the third-gen iPhone SE, green colors of the iPhone 13 and iPhone 13 Pro, the powerful Mac Studio desktop, and the 5K Studio Display external monitor.

Apple Readies Several New Macs With Next-Generation M2 Chips (bloomberg.com) 47

Apple has started widespread internal testing of several new Mac models with next-generation M2 chips, according to developer logs, part of its push to make more powerful computers using homegrown processors. Bloomberg: The company is testing at least nine new Macs with four different M2-based chips -- the successors to the current M1 line -- with third-party apps in its App Store, according to the logs, which were corroborated by people familiar with the matter. The move is a key step in the development process, suggesting that the new machines may be nearing release in the coming months. The M2 chip is Apple's latest attempt to push the boundaries of computer processing after a split with Intel in recent years. Apple has gradually replaced Intel chips with its own silicon, and now looks to make further gains with a more advanced line. After years of slow growth, the Mac computer division enjoyed a resurgence the past two years, helped in part by home office workers buying new equipment. The business generated $35.2 billion in sales the past fiscal year, about 10% of Apple's total.

How Apple's Monster M1 Ultra Chip Keeps Moore's Law Alive 109

By combining two processors into one, the company has squeezed a surprising amount of performance out of silicon. From a report: "UltraFusion gave us the tools we needed to be able to fill up that box with as much compute as we could," Tim Millet, vice president of hardware technologies at Apple, says of the Mac Studio. Benchmarking of the M1 Ultra has shown it to be competitive with the fastest high-end computer chips and graphics processor on the market. Millet says some of the chip's capabilities, such as its potential for running AI applications, will become apparent over time, as developers port over the necessary software libraries. The M1 Ultra is part of a broader industry shift toward more modular chips. Intel is developing a technology that allows different pieces of silicon, dubbed "chiplets," to be stacked on top of one another to create custom designs that do not need to be redesigned from scratch. The company's CEO, Pat Gelsinger, has identified this "advanced packaging" as one pillar of a grand turnaround plan. Intel's competitor AMD is already using a 3D stacking technology from TSMC to build some server and high-end PC chips. This month, Intel, AMD, Samsung, TSMC, and ARM announced a consortium to work on a new standard for chiplet designs. In a more radical approach, the M1 Ultra uses the chiplet concept to connect entire chips together.

Apple's new chip is all about increasing overall processing power. "Depending on how you define Moore's law, this approach allows you to create systems that engage many more transistors than what fits on one chip," says Jesus del Alamo, a professor at MIT who researches new chip components. He adds that it is significant that TSMC, at the cutting edge of chipmaking, is looking for new ways to keep performance rising. "Clearly, the chip industry sees that progress in the future is going to come not only from Moore's law but also from creating systems that could be fabricated by different technologies yet to be brought together," he says. "Others are doing similar things, and we certainly see a trend towards more of these chiplet designs," adds Linley Gwennap, author of the Microprocessor Report, an industry newsletter. The rise of modular chipmaking might help boost the performance of future devices, but it could also change the economics of chipmaking. Without Moore's law, a chip with twice the transistors may cost twice as much. "With chiplets, I can still sell you the base chip for, say, $300, the double chip for $600, and the uber-double chip for $1,200," says Todd Austin, an electrical engineer at the University of Michigan.

DuckDuckGo's Privacy-Centric Browser Arrives on Mac (theverge.com) 38

DuckDuckGo's privacy-focused browsing app is available in beta on Mac, but you'll have to join a private waitlist to gain access. From a report: Just like the mobile browsing app, DuckDuckGo on Mac uses the DuckDuckGo search engine by default, automatically blocks web trackers, and comes with the famous "Fire" button that burns up your browsing history and tabs in a single click. The browsing app also comes with a new feature that's supposed to help block those pesky cookie consent pop-ups that appear when you first open a website. DuckDuckGo says it will clear them on 50 percent of sites, while automatically selecting the option that blocks or minimizes the cookies that track you. Allison Goodman, the senior communications manager at DuckDuckGo, told The Verge that the company plans on increasing this coverage "significantly" as the beta progresses. You'll also gain access to a privacy feed that appears on DuckDuckGo's homepage.

Has the Era of Fixing Your Own Phone Nearly Arrived? (theverge.com) 62

A new article on the Verge argues that the era of fixing your own phone "has nearly arrived." When I called up iFixit CEO Kyle Wiens, I figured he'd be celebrating — after years of fighting for right-to-repair, big name companies like Google and Samsung have suddenly agreed to provide spare parts for their phones. Not only that, they signed deals with him to sell those parts through iFixit, alongside the company's repair guides and tools. So did Valve.

But Wiens says he's not done making deals yet. "There are more coming," he says, one as soon as a couple of months from now. (No, it's not Apple.) Motorola was actually the first to sign on nearly four years ago. And if Apple meaningfully joins them in offering spare parts to consumers — like it promised to do by early 2022 — the era of fixing your own phone may be underway. Last October, the United States effectively made it legal to open up many devices for the purpose of repair with an exemption to the Digital Millennium Copyright Act. Now, the necessary parts are arriving.

What changed? Weren't these companies fighting tooth and nail to keep right-for-repair off the table, sometimes sneakily stopping bills at the last minute? Sure. But some legislation is getting through anyhow... and one French law in particular might have been the tipping point.

"The thing that's changing the game more than anything else is the French repairability scorecard," says Wiens, referring to a 2021 law that requires tech companies to reveal how repairable their phones are — on a scale of 0.0 to 10.0 — right next to their pricetag. Even Apple was forced to add repairability scores — but Wiens points me to this press release by Samsung instead. When Samsung commissioned a study to check whether the French repairability scores were meaningful, it didn't just find the scorecards were handy — it found a staggering 80 percent of respondents would be willing to give up their favorite brand for a product that scored higher.

"There have been extensive studies done on the scorecard and it's working," says Wiens. "It's driving behavior, it's shifting consumer buying patterns." Stick, meet carrot. Seeing an opportunity, Wiens suggests, pushed these companies to take up iFixit on the deal.

Nathan Proctor, director of the Campaign for the Right to Repair at the US Public Interest Research Group (US PIRG), still thinks the stick is primarily to thank. "It feels cheeky to say 100 percent... but none of this happens unless there's a threat of legislation... These companies have known these were issues for a long time, and until we organized enough clout for it to start seeming inevitable, none of the big ones had particularly good repair programs and now they're all announcing them," Proctor notes.

Apple Announces Digital WWDC 2022 Event (macrumors.com) 23

Apple today announced that its 33rd annual Worldwide Developers Conference is set to take place from Monday, June 6 to Friday, June 10. As with the last several WWDC events, the 2022 Worldwide Developers Conference will be held digitally with no in-person gathering. MacRumors reports: There will be no cost associated with WWDC 2022, with all developers worldwide able to attend the virtual event. Apple plans to provide sessions and labs for developers to allow them to learn about the new features and software updates that will be introduced at the event, plus there will be a traditional Swift Student Challenge.

Apple says that this year's event will feature additional information sessions, more learning labs, more digital lounges to engage with attendees, and more localized content, with the aim of making WWDC22 "a truly global event." Though the event will be digital, Apple also plans to host a special day for developers and students at Apple Park on June 6 to watch the keynote and State of the Union videos together. Space will be limited, and Apple will take applications.

Apple is expected to hold an online keynote on the first day of WWDC to unveil new software, including iOS 16, iPadOS 16, macOS 13, tvOS 16, and watchOS 9. It is also possible we could see new hardware at WWDC, as Apple is working on an updated Apple silicon Mac Pro, a new version of the MacBook Air, and more.

'Infinite Mac' Project Lets You Boot Up Mac OS In Your Browser (arstechnica.com) 10

An anonymous reader quotes a report from Ars Technica: What makes the ["Infinite Mac"] project unique isn't necessarily the fact that it's browser-based; it has been possible to run old DOS, Windows, and Mac OS versions in browser windows for quite a while now. Instead, it's the creative solutions that developer Mihai Parparita has come up with to enable persistent storage, fast download speeds, reduced processor usage, and file transfers between the classic Mac and whatever host system you're running it on. Parparita details some of his work in this blog post.

Beginning with a late 2017 browser-based port of the Basilisk II emulator, Parparita wanted to install old apps to more faithfully re-create the experience of using an old Mac, but he wanted to do it without requiring huge downloads or running as a separate program as the Macintosh.js project does. To solve the download problem, Parparita compressed the disk image and broke it up into 256K chunks that are downloaded on demand rather than up front. "Along with some old fashioned web optimizations, this makes the emulator show the Mac's boot screen in a second and be fully booted in 3 seconds, even with a cold HTTP cache," Parparita wrote.

CPU usage was another issue. Old operating systems and processors didn't really distinguish between active and idle processor states -- your computer was either on or off. So when you emulate these old systems, they'll ramp one of your CPU cores to 100% whether you're actually using the emulator or not. Parparita used existing Basilisk II features to reduce CPU usage, only requiring full performance when "there was user input or a screen refresh was required." Infinite Mac won't run later releases of classic Mac OS (including 8.5, 8.6, and 9) because those releases ran exclusively on PowerPC Macs, dropping support for the old Motorola 68000-based processors. Emulators like QEMU are capable of emulating PowerPC Macs, but (at least as far as I am aware) there are no easy browser-based implementations that exist. Not yet, anyway.

The Untold Story of the Creation of GIF At CompuServe In 1987 (fastcompany.com) 43

Back in 1987 Alexander Trevor worked with the GIF format's creator, Steve Wilhite, at CompuServe. 35 years later Fast Company tech editor Harry McCracken (also Slashdot reader harrymcc) located Trevor for the inside story: Wilhite did not come up with the GIF format in order to launch a billion memes. It was 1987, and he was a software engineer at CompuServe, the most important online service until an upstart called America Online took off in the 1990s. And he developed the format in response to a request from CompuServe executive Alexander "Sandy" Trevor. (Trevor's most legendary contribution to CompuServe was not instigating GIF: He also invented the service's CB Simulator — the first consumer chat rooms and one of the earliest manifestation of social networking, period. That one he coded himself as a weekend project in 1980.)

GIF came to be because online services such as CompuServe were getting more graphical, but the computer makers of the time — such as Apple, Commodore, and IBM — all had their own proprietary image types. "We didn't want to have to put up images in 79 different formats," explains Trevor. CompuServe needed one universal graphics format.

Even though the World Wide Web and digital cameras were still in the future, work was already underway on the image format that came to be known as JPEG. But it wasn't optimized for CompuServe's needs: For example, stock charts and weather graphics didn't render crisply. So Trevor asked Wilhite to create an image file type that looked good and downloaded quickly at a time when a 2,400 bits-per-second dial-up modem was considered torrid. Reading a technical journal, Wilhite came across a discussion of an efficient compression technique known as LZW for its creators — Abraham Limpel, Jacob Ziv, and Terry Welch. It turned out to be an ideal foundation for what CompuServe was trying to build, and allowed GIF to pack a lot of image information into as few bytes as possible. (Much later, computing giant Unisys, which gained a patent for LZW, threatened companies that used it with lawsuits, leading to a licensing agreement with CompuServe and the creation of the patent-free PNG image format.)

GIF officially debuted on June 15, 1987. "It met my requirements, and it was extremely useful for CompuServe," says Trevor....

GIF was also versatile, offering the ability to store the multiple pictures that made it handy for creating mini-movies as well as static images. And it spread beyond CompuServe, showing up in Mosaic, the first graphical web browser, and then in Netscape Navigator. The latter browser gave GIFs the ability to run in an infinite loop, a crucial feature that only added to their hypnotic quality. Seeing cartoon hamsters dance for a split second is no big whoop, but watching them shake their booties endlessly was just one of many cultural moments that GIFs have given us.
